Inventory Policy for High Backorder Items,
Abstract
In this study the item-by-item performance of the Standard Base Supply System (SBSS) is compared with the results of an aggregate model that minimizes backorders. We found that a small group of relatively inexpensive items generate nearly 90% of the units backordered in the SBSS in a year. By adding a lot size to the reorder point for those high backorder items, we can significantly reduce the number of units backordered. In this study we show how to identify these items, the theory behind the proposed inventory policy change, and the stock fund impact of implementing the policy change.
